The RT5350 is a MIPS SoC by RaLink.
The SoC is pretty similar to the already in-tree RT305X.
This patch adds :
- Support for the RT5350F
- Selection of SoC in kernel config
- Add kernel config RT5350_BASE and corresponding hint files with sane
defaults.
- Add kernel config for the Olimex RT5350 EVB and hints files
- Configuration of GPIO via pinmask/pinon and function_set/fonction_clear hint
value.
- Add a pinin hint value to configure a GPIO as input at boot.
